Topic 4: CPU Scheduling Quiz

Topic 4: CPU Scheduling Quiz

University

10 Qs

quiz-placeholder

Similar activities

OS_unit1

OS_unit1

University

10 Qs

คำถามบทที่ 3 กระบวนการ (Process)

คำถามบทที่ 3 กระบวนการ (Process)

University

12 Qs

CPU scheduling

CPU scheduling

University

13 Qs

Quiz 3 OS Jun 2019

Quiz 3 OS Jun 2019

University

10 Qs

CPU Scheduling Introduction Quiz

CPU Scheduling Introduction Quiz

University

10 Qs

SYCS - OS UNIT 1 - Chapter 3

SYCS - OS UNIT 1 - Chapter 3

University

10 Qs

operating systems

operating systems

University

15 Qs

OS Fun Review 5

OS Fun Review 5

University

10 Qs

Topic 4: CPU Scheduling Quiz

Topic 4: CPU Scheduling Quiz

Assessment

Quiz

Computers

University

Hard

Created by

Wardatul Azman

Used 6+ times

FREE Resource

10 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is a process in the context of CPU scheduling?

A type of computer virus

A type of computer chip

A type of computer memory

A program that is currently being executed by the CPU

2.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Explain the concept of process scheduling.

Process scheduling is the method used to manage the storage of files on a computer.

Process scheduling is the process of organizing tasks in a to-do list.

Process scheduling refers to the process of designing a new software application.

Process scheduling is the method used by operating systems to manage the execution of multiple processes on a single processor.

3.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What are the different states a process can be in?

on hold, in progress, finished, halted

starting, stopping, pausing, finishing

ready, running, waiting, terminated

sleeping, active, paused, completed

4.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is interprocess communication and why is it important in CPU scheduling?

Interprocess communication is used to increase the speed of CPU scheduling

Interprocess communication is only used for error handling in CPU scheduling

Interprocess communication allows processes to coordinate and synchronize their activities.

Interprocess communication is not important in CPU scheduling

5.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Discuss the challenges of real-time scheduling in CPU scheduling.

Ensuring efficient use of memory

Balancing multiple tasks at once

Dealing with long-term planning

Meeting strict deadlines for time-sensitive tasks

6.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is the purpose of context switching in CPU scheduling?

To save and restore the state of a CPU process

To increase the speed of CPU scheduling

To determine the priority of a CPU process

To calculate the total memory usage of the CPU

7.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Which are false about ordinary pipes

Unidirectional

Parent-child relationship

Two-way communication

Half-duplex

Create a free account and access millions of resources

Create resources
Host any resource
Get auto-graded reports
or continue with
Microsoft
Apple
Others
By signing up, you agree to our Terms of Service & Privacy Policy
Already have an account?